Israeli Judokas Face Alleged Antisemitic Abuse in Poland

Israeli judokas face alleged antisemitic abuse in Poland. Youth athletes aged 7 to 16 were allegedly targeted with antisemitic chants and their coaches shoved at a tournament near Krakow. The post Israeli judokas face alleged antisemitic abuse in Poland appeared first on Jerusalem World News.

An incident occurred during a children's and youth judo tournament in Bielsko-Biała. The Israeli Embassy reported that the Israeli team was verbally and physically attacked. According to the organizers, the coach of one of the Israeli teams attacked the referee. Police were called to the scene.

During an international judo tournament for children and youth in Bielsko-Biała (Silesian Voivodeship), an incident involving an Israeli team occurred. The Israeli Embassy reported that its players "were attacked verbally and physically." Organizers deny these reports, claiming that the coach of one of the Israeli teams attacked the referee.
